Output 88303125c83bf1d9f0016c3610b6c2086a5aca84e0241b9b149341608185f968:11

value
898084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d46af160e78ec415b3dc479705a6f7640e55085 OP_EQUALVERIFY OP_CHECKSIG
address
16aztucvwfqWymodeSXH6dexw7aYL5ucrx
transaction
88303125c83bf1d9f0016c3610b6c2086a5aca84e0241b9b149341608185f968
spent
true